Transaction8c18d289314058f8448aa2f1c176411972769b2aceb8c71ed88ac570aa8f258d
Inputs and outputs
Coinbase
No Inputs (Newly Generated Coins)
50 VEIL
49.75 VEIL
0.25 VEIL
Veil Explorer